Dans les milieux académiques francophones, notamment en astrophysique, le FITS est une norme incontournable. La conversion J2C vers FITS est souvent nécessaire pour l'intégration d'images issues de capteurs récents dans des bases de données ou des logiciels d'analyse existants.
